No idea what's going on, but nice smile and congrats on the therapy.

Word of advice, therapy is not like the media portrays. Most therapists are normal-ass people. They're not geniuses and they can't read minds.
Think of it like any other (healthy) relationship. You meet and talk a few times, get to know each other, and figure out if you're a right fit. A good therapist will just be someone who is more educated and has a more objective view. But since they don't know you, you are allowed to push back if something they say seems/feels wrong or off. Since they weren't there, you don't always have to take their interpretation of events at face value. Especially since every one of us is an unreliable narrator of our own stories.

So, honesty is what's most important. Therapists have to believe you. They can only help you if you're honest with them and yourself.
